Determining the least popular fear can be challenging due to the vast range of individual experiences and the lack of comprehensive global data on fears. Fears are highly personal and can vary widely from person to person. Common fears include heights, spiders, or public speaking, but less common fears might not be as well documented. Spectrophobia, the fear of mirrors and one's own reflection, or Ablutophobia, the fear of bathing, could be considered less common, though it's difficult to accurately label any fear as the 'least popular' without extensive research.
